I have replaced the water valve because it was showing too many ohms across the solenoid. Checked the voltage at the ice maker and it showed 118 VAC. Replaced ice maker assembly. Even went so far as to use a blow dryer on the inlet line to make sure no ice was in the line. What would be my next step?
